Abstract

In the new era, science education emphasizes the cultivation of core literacy. To effectively implement the national policies on science education and address the challenges faced by traditional physics education, such as the need for further optimization in talent-cultivation methods, transition between educational stages, and teaching interaction, the PT talent-cultivation model, with its mechanism of “content-driven, project-based, literacy-integrated,” has established a practical paradigm for science education through project-based learning, teamwork, and communication and discussion. It shows high compatibility and adaptability to the requirements of science education in the new era and has important demonstrative value for deepening educational reform. Research shows that the PT talent-cultivation model accurately responds to the national strategic requirements and policy guidance for science education in the new era, provides a replicable practical path for the transformation from knowledge transmission to the comprehensive and coordinated development of literacy, and helps the high quality development of science education and the cultivation of innovative talents.
